Markdown nestede lister

Markdown nestede lister
“I Markdown er det to typer lister som kan opprettes. Den første er den uordnede listen (Bulleted), og den andre er den bestilte listen (nummerert). Vi vil lage nestede lister ved hjelp av begge typer markdown -lister i denne opplæringen.

For implementering av skriptet er verktøyet vi bruker her Visual Studio Code.”

Eksempel nr. 1: Uordnede nestede lister i Markdown

Denne demonstrasjonen vil utdype teknikken for å hekke de uordnede listene i Markdown. For å lage en uordnet liste, gir Markdown oss forskjellige alternativer som kan brukes til å generere en uordnet liste. Dette er pluss tegn (+), streker (-) eller stjerner (*). Du kan bruke noen av disse alternativene. La oss se hvordan hver av disse vil fungere.

Vi oppretter først en liste ved å legge til strekene (-) før listeelementet. Vi har laget en liste. For å lage en liste med streker, er mønsteret som må følges at vi må legge til en strek (-), deretter et rom, og navnet på listen. For neste liste vil markdown oppdage formatet og legge til det foregående tempoet i neste skriptlinje automatisk. Når vi bruker strekene (-) for å lage en uordnet liste, når vi går til neste linje, legger den automatisk dashen. Her har vi laget en liste med 5 elementer som er "Pakistan", "Iran", "Afghanistan", "India" og den siste varen, "Kina".

Forhåndsvisningsvinduet viser oss 5 listeelementer som vises med kuler. Resultatet kan sees i øyeblikksbildet vedlagt nedenfor.

Nå vil vi bruke Plus -tegnet (+) -tegnet for å gjøre markeringen til uordnet liste.

Her har vi bare erstattet strekene (-) med pluss-tegnet (+).

Dette gir oss den samme utgangen som vi fikk for ovennevnte treningsteknikk.

Nå skal vi sjekke det med den siste teknikken, som legger til stjernene (*) før listeelementets navn.

Ved å legge til stjernene, får vi til og med de samme kulelistene.

Vi har lært av dette at alle disse teknikkene vil gjengi den samme uordnede listen med elementer vist med kuler.

For å lage nestede lister, er teknikkene som kan brukes de samme som de som er diskutert ovenfor. Vi velger Dash (-) -teknikken for å lage uordnede nestede lister. Vi la først til en overskrift ved å bruke hasj (#) -symbolet og et rom før overskriften. Den ene “#” refererer til “H1” overskriftsstil. Teksten vi har spesifisert for overskriften er "land med hovedbyer", så dette vil være vår viktigste overskrift. Så i neste linje introduserer vi en underoverskrift ved å bruke trippel hashene, som refererer til "H3" -overskriften. Og strengen for overskriften er "listen over land, og hovedstedene deres er:". Den nestede listen begynner deretter. Vi har lagt til Dash (-) -symbolet for å lage det første listeelementet som "Pakistan".

For å legge til en liste i denne listen, må vi i neste linje i skriptet legge til fire mellomrom. Da er Dash (-), plassen og navnet på sublisten skrevet. Så vi den første listeartikelen som "Pakistan", og innenfor det blir sublisten lagt til som "Islamabad", deretter neste element på listen som "Iran" med sublistelement "Teheran", 3Rd Listelement vedlagt er “Afghanistan” som har sublistelement “Kabul”, deretter “India” med nestet listeelement “Delhi” og til slutt “Kina” som har sublistelement “Beijing”.

Den gjengitte utgangen kan observeres på bildet som er festet nedenfor, som viser en overskrift, underoverskrifter og deretter nestet uordnede markdown -lister.

Eksempel nr. 2: Bestilte nestede lister i Markdown

Denne illustrasjonen vil la oss forstå de bestilte listene og hvordan vi lager nestede bestilte lister.

De bestilte listene er de hvis elementer er lagt til med tallene. For å opprette en bestilt liste, vil nummeret som er spesifisert for det første listeelementet, bestemme startnummeret til output -sekvensiell listeummer. La oss lære det gjennom et skript.

Vi har laget en liste med 7 elementer som "rød", "blå", "lilla", "oransje", "gul", "rosa" og "hvit". For å lage en bestilt liste med disse varene, har vi lagt til tallene, en periode og navnet på varen. Her har vi startet listen med nummeret “1”, som går i rekkefølge opp til “7”.

Her er utdataene for det ovennevnte Markdown-skriptet.

La oss nå se hva som vil skje hvis vi legger til tilfeldige tall på listen med de samme elementene.

Vi har endret tallene og nå lagt dem til som "1", "4", "3", "7", "2", "7" og "5". Du kan observere tallene blir lagt til tilfeldig.

Men forhåndsvisningsvinduet viser oss utgangslisten med en sekvensiell liste fra 1. Dette er fordi Markdown bare vurderer det første medfølgende nummeret og deretter bestiller listen sekvensielt, og starter fra det aktuelle nummeret og fremover.

For enkelhets skyld vil vi gi et annet eksempel der det første nummeret vi har spesifisert er "5" og deretter noen tilfeldige tall.

Du kan se i utgangen at listen starter fra 5 og deretter legger tallene sekvensielt og videre. Så du må begynne å nummerere listeelementene fra “1” så det går i riktig rekkefølge.

Vi kan også lage en nestet bestilt liste i Markdown. For dette har vi først lagt til en overskrift ved hjelp av single Hash (#) som "Nested Ordered List", og deretter opprettes underoverskriften med "H3" -stilen ved hjelp av 3 hashes (###) med teksten "Dette er vår Nestet bestilt liste i Markdown: ”. Nå som vi bruker listen som er opprettet ovenfor, har vi lagt til noen sublister i den. Sublistene er opprettet ved å legge til fire mellomrom og deretter nummeret, et rom og varenavnet. Sublisten må starte fra tallet “1”. Så vi har lagt til sublistelementer til listeartiklene “Purple” og “Yellow” som “Plum”, “Yellow” og “Lime”.

Dette vil gi oss den resulterende nestede bestilte listen, som vises i øyeblikksbildet nedenfor.

Eksempel nr. 3: Bland nestede lister i Markdown

I siste tilfelle vil vi se hvordan du oppretter en nestet liste ved hjelp av de bestilte og uordnede listene. Vi vil lage en uordnet liste; Innenfor denne listen vil en bestilt liste bli generert, og deretter vil en annen uordnet sublist bli initialisert i den bestilte listen.

Vi har først lagt til en overskrift og en underoverskrift, og så begynner vi den første listen med den uordnede listen. Det første elementet på den uordnede listen er “Asia”; Innenfor denne listen har vi startet en ny bestilt liste med navnet på det aktuelle innholdets land. Og så, under navnet Sublist, har vi laget en annen sublist som holder navnet på en by i det spesifikke landet. Så for den uordnede listeelementet "Asia" har vi bestilt listeartikler "Pakistan", "Iran" og "Kina". Og under den bestilte listeelementet "Pakistan", har vi et uordnet listeelement "Rawalpindi".

Du kan se resten av skriptet på bildet nedenfor:

Dette gir oss følgende utfall som viser nestede lister:

Konklusjon

Denne guiden utdypet teknikkene for å lage lister og hekke dem sammen. Vi har forklart de to forskjellige typene lister som er uordnede og bestilte lister. Vi gjennomførte 3 forekomster i denne artikkelen. I det første eksemplet lærte vi å lage en enkel uordnet liste og nestede uordnede lister. Så de 2nd Illustrasjon snakket om de bestilte listene og nestede bestilte lister. Den siste forekomsten la vekt på hekkingen av bestilte og uordnede lister sammen.